    What’s it like working at Opulent Solutions?

    AI summary of recent reviews

    Employees at Opulent Solutions consistently praise the excellent teamwork and friendly, helpful colleagues, along with supportive supervisors who are understanding and appreciative of employee contributions. The company offers opportunities for learning and development through training courses and hands-on experience, and the working environment is described as comfortable and conducive to productivity. Some departments also provide good work/life balance, demonstrating the company's commitment to employee wellbeing.

    However, there are some potential challenges to consider. Employees have noted that salary scales may be below industry averages and yearly increments can be difficult to secure. Management processes could benefit from greater consistency, and the workload can be demanding, with expectations of overtime particularly in production roles. The company's rapid growth requires employees to adapt quickly to changing demands, and some systems and technology may be outdated, requiring manual workarounds. Practical concerns include limited parking and the lack of an on-site canteen.
